Simple Lifestyle Changes to Help Control Your Blood Glucose Levels
17 Sep 2025 By Sydney A. Westphal, M.D.

Simple Lifestyle Changes to Help Control Your Blood Glucose Levels

Managing blood glucose levels is crucial for overall health, particularly for individuals with diabetes or those at risk of developing the condition. While medical treatments are often necessary, simple lifestyle changes can significantly impact blood glucose control. These changes encompass dietary adjustments, physical activity, stress management, and sleep hygiene. By integrating these practices into your daily routine, you can proactively manage your glucose levels, improve your well-being, and potentially reduce your reliance on medication.

Why Blood Glucose Control Matters

Maintaining stable blood glucose levels is essential for preventing complications associated with diabetes, such as nerve damage (neuropathy), kidney disease (nephropathy), cardiovascular issues, and vision problems. Fluctuations in blood sugar can also lead to fatigue, increased thirst, frequent urination, and impaired wound healing. Effective glucose management not only mitigates these risks but also enhances energy levels and improves overall quality of life. Implementing small, sustainable lifestyle adjustments can contribute to long-term health benefits.

Dietary Adjustments for Better Glucose Control

Diet plays a pivotal role in managing blood glucose. Making informed choices about what and how you eat can lead to significant improvements. Here are some key dietary changes to consider:

1. Focus on Low Glycemic Index (GI) Foods

The glycemic index (GI) measures how quickly a food raises blood glucose levels. Foods with a low GI are digested and absorbed more slowly, leading to a gradual rise in blood sugar.

Examples of Low GI Foods:

  • Non-starchy vegetables: Broccoli, spinach, kale, and peppers.
  • Whole grains: Oats, quinoa, brown rice.
  • Legumes: Lentils, beans, chickpeas.
  • Fruits: Apples, berries, oranges.

Table of High and Low GI Foods:

| Food Category | High GI Foods | Low GI Foods | |---------------|-------------------------|-----------------------------| | Grains | White bread, white rice | Whole grain bread, brown rice | | Fruits | Watermelon, dates | Apples, berries | | Vegetables | Potatoes, corn | Broccoli, spinach | | Snacks | Processed snacks, candy | Nuts, seeds |

2. Emphasize Fiber Intake

Fiber slows down the absorption of sugar into the bloodstream, promoting stable glucose levels. Aim for a minimum of 25-30 grams of fiber per day.

Sources of Fiber:

  • Fruits and vegetables: Especially those with edible skins or seeds.
  • Whole grains: Oatmeal, whole wheat bread, and brown rice.
  • Legumes: Beans, lentils, and peas.
  • Nuts and seeds: Chia seeds, flaxseeds, almonds.

3. Control Portion Sizes

Eating large portions can lead to rapid spikes in blood glucose. Using smaller plates, measuring food, and paying attention to hunger cues can help regulate portion sizes.

Tips for Portion Control:

  • Use smaller plates: This can trick your brain into feeling satisfied with less food.
  • Measure food: Use measuring cups and spoons to accurately portion out meals.
  • Read food labels: Be mindful of serving sizes listed on packaged foods.
  • Eat slowly: Allow your brain time to register fullness before overeating.

4. Limit Sugary Beverages and Processed Foods

Sugary drinks like soda, juice, and sweetened teas can cause rapid glucose spikes. Processed foods are often high in refined carbohydrates, unhealthy fats, and added sugars, all of which can negatively impact blood glucose control.

Alternatives to Sugary Beverages:

  • Water: Infuse with fruits or herbs for added flavor.
  • Unsweetened tea: Herbal teas, green tea, or black tea.
  • Sparkling water: Add a splash of fruit juice for a refreshing drink.

5. Spread Carbohydrate Intake Throughout the Day

Instead of consuming all your carbohydrates in one meal, spread them evenly throughout the day. This helps maintain consistent blood glucose levels and prevents drastic fluctuations.

Example Meal Plan:

  • Breakfast: Oatmeal with berries and nuts.
  • Lunch: Salad with grilled chicken or tofu and a whole-grain roll.
  • Dinner: Baked salmon with steamed vegetables and quinoa.
  • Snacks: A piece of fruit, a handful of nuts, or yogurt.

The Role of Physical Activity in Glucose Management

Physical activity is a powerful tool for managing blood glucose levels. It increases insulin sensitivity, allowing cells to utilize glucose more effectively, and helps burn excess glucose for energy.

1. Aim for Regular Aerobic Exercise

Aerobic exercise increases your heart rate and breathing, improving cardiovascular health and enhancing glucose metabolism.

Examples of Aerobic Exercise:

  • Walking: A simple, accessible activity that can be incorporated into your daily routine.
  • Jogging: An effective way to burn calories and improve cardiovascular fitness.
  • Swimming: A low-impact exercise that's gentle on the joints.
  • Cycling: A great option for both cardio and commuting.
  • Dancing: A fun and engaging way to get your heart rate up.

Recommended Aerobic Exercise Guidelines:

  • Aim for at least 150 minutes of moderate-intensity aerobic exercise per week.
  • Break it down into 30-minute sessions, five days a week.
  • Alternatively, engage in 75 minutes of vigorous-intensity aerobic exercise per week.

2. Incorporate Strength Training

Examples of Strength Training Exercises:

  • Weightlifting: Using dumbbells, barbells, or weight machines.
  • Bodyweight exercises: Push-ups, squats, lunges, and planks.
  • Resistance band exercises: Utilizing resistance bands to provide tension during workouts.

Recommended Strength Training Guidelines:

  • Engage in strength training exercises at least two days per week.
  • Focus on working all major muscle groups, including the legs, back, chest, shoulders, and arms.
  • Perform 2-3 sets of 8-12 repetitions for each exercise.

3. Monitor Blood Glucose Before and After Exercise

It’s important to monitor your blood glucose levels before and after exercise to understand how your body responds to different activities. This helps you adjust your diet and exercise routine accordingly.

Tips for Monitoring Blood Glucose During Exercise:

  • Check your blood glucose before, during (for prolonged activities), and after exercise.
  • Carry a fast-acting source of glucose, such as glucose tablets or fruit juice, in case your blood sugar drops too low.
  • Adjust your insulin or medication dosage, if necessary, in consultation with your healthcare provider.

4. Stay Active Throughout the Day

In addition to structured exercise, aim to stay active throughout the day. Take the stairs instead of the elevator, walk during your lunch break, and stand up to stretch every hour.

Strategies for Increasing Daily Activity:

  • Take the stairs: Opt for the stairs instead of elevators or escalators.
  • Walk during breaks: Use breaks at work or school to take a short walk.
  • Stand up and stretch: Get up and stretch every hour to prevent prolonged sitting.
  • Park further away: Park your car further from your destination and walk the extra distance.
  • Do household chores: Engage in active household chores like gardening or vacuuming.

5. Consult with a Healthcare Professional

Before starting any new exercise program, especially if you have diabetes or other health conditions, consult with your healthcare provider. They can provide personalized recommendations based on your individual needs and health status.


Stress Management Techniques for Glucose Regulation

Stress can significantly impact blood glucose levels. When stressed, the body releases hormones like cortisol and adrenaline, which can raise blood sugar. Managing stress effectively is crucial for maintaining stable glucose control.

1. Practice Mindfulness and Meditation

How to Practice Mindfulness:

  • Focus on your breath: Pay attention to the sensation of your breath entering and leaving your body.
  • Observe your thoughts: Notice your thoughts without getting carried away by them.
  • Engage your senses: Pay attention to the sights, sounds, smells, tastes, and textures around you.

How to Meditate:

  • Find a quiet place: Sit or lie down in a comfortable position in a quiet environment.
  • Focus on your breath: Concentrate on your breath, counting each inhale and exhale.
  • Use a guided meditation: Listen to a guided meditation recording for structured relaxation.

2. Engage in Relaxing Activities

Participating in enjoyable and relaxing activities can help alleviate stress and lower blood glucose levels.

Examples of Relaxing Activities:

  • Reading: Immerse yourself in a good book.
  • Listening to music: Enjoy calming music or nature sounds.
  • Spending time in nature: Take a walk in the park or garden.
  • Practicing yoga: Engage in gentle stretching and breathing exercises.
  • Taking a warm bath: Relax in a warm bath with Epsom salts or essential oils.

3. Prioritize Sleep

Sleep deprivation can increase stress hormones and negatively impact blood glucose control. Aim for 7-9 hours of quality sleep per night.

Tips for Improving Sleep Quality:

  • Establish a regular sleep schedule: Go to bed and wake up at the same time every day, even on weekends.
  • Create a relaxing bedtime routine: Wind down with a warm bath, reading, or gentle stretching.
  • Optimize your sleep environment: Make sure your bedroom is dark, quiet, and cool.
  • Avoid caffeine and alcohol before bed: These substances can interfere with sleep.
  • Limit screen time before bed: The blue light emitted from electronic devices can disrupt your sleep cycle.

4. Connect with Social Support

Having strong social connections and support networks can help buffer against stress and improve overall well-being.

Ways to Connect with Social Support:

  • Spend time with loved ones: Connect with family and friends regularly.
  • Join a support group: Share experiences and receive support from others with similar challenges.
  • Engage in community activities: Participate in local events and organizations.
  • Volunteer: Give back to your community and connect with like-minded individuals.

5. Practice Deep Breathing Exercises

Deep breathing exercises can activate the parasympathetic nervous system, which promotes relaxation and reduces stress.

How to Practice Deep Breathing:

  • Find a comfortable position: Sit or lie down in a relaxed position.
  • Inhale deeply: Breathe in slowly through your nose, filling your abdomen with air.
  • Exhale slowly: Breathe out slowly through your mouth, releasing all the air from your abdomen.
  • Repeat: Continue for several minutes, focusing on your breath and letting go of tension.

The Importance of Sleep Hygiene for Blood Glucose Control

Adequate and restful sleep is vital for overall health, including the regulation of blood glucose levels. Poor sleep can disrupt hormones, increase stress, and lead to insulin resistance. Improving sleep hygiene can positively impact blood sugar control.

1. Maintain a Consistent Sleep Schedule

Going to bed and waking up at the same time every day helps regulate your body's natural sleep-wake cycle (circadian rhythm). This consistency can improve the quality and duration of your sleep, leading to better glucose control.

Tips for Maintaining a Consistent Sleep Schedule:

  • Set a bedtime and wake-up time: Stick to your schedule even on weekends and holidays.
  • Avoid sleeping in: Resist the temptation to sleep in on weekends, as this can disrupt your sleep cycle.
  • Be consistent: Try to go to bed and wake up at the same time every day, even if you didn't sleep well the night before.

2. Create a Relaxing Bedtime Routine

Establishing a relaxing routine before bed can help signal to your body that it's time to sleep.

Examples of Relaxing Bedtime Rituals:

  • Take a warm bath or shower: The change in body temperature can promote relaxation.
  • Read a book: Choose a relaxing book that isn't too stimulating.
  • Listen to calming music: Play soft, soothing music to unwind.
  • Practice gentle stretching or yoga: Engage in gentle stretching or yoga poses to release tension.
  • Meditate or practice mindfulness: Focus on your breath and clear your mind.

3. Optimize Your Sleep Environment

Your sleep environment can significantly impact the quality of your sleep. Create a comfortable and conducive environment for rest.

Tips for Optimizing Your Sleep Environment:

  • Keep your bedroom dark: Use blackout curtains or an eye mask to block out light.
  • Keep your bedroom quiet: Use earplugs or a white noise machine to mask distracting sounds.
  • Keep your bedroom cool: Maintain a cool temperature, around 60-67°F (15-19°C), for optimal sleep.
  • Use a comfortable mattress and pillows: Invest in a supportive mattress and pillows that suit your sleeping style.
  • Remove electronic devices: Keep electronic devices like TVs, computers, and smartphones out of your bedroom.

4. Limit Caffeine and Alcohol Intake

Caffeine and alcohol can interfere with sleep, especially when consumed close to bedtime.

How Caffeine and Alcohol Affect Sleep:

  • Caffeine: Stimulates the nervous system, making it harder to fall asleep and stay asleep.
  • Alcohol: Initially promotes relaxation but can disrupt sleep later in the night, leading to fragmented sleep.

Recommendations for Limiting Caffeine and Alcohol:

  • Avoid caffeine in the afternoon and evening: Limit caffeine intake after midday.
  • Limit alcohol consumption: If you drink alcohol, do so in moderation and avoid it close to bedtime.
  • Stay hydrated: Drink plenty of water throughout the day to prevent dehydration, which can disrupt sleep.

5. Manage Screen Time Before Bed

The blue light emitted from electronic devices can suppress the production of melatonin, a hormone that regulates sleep.

Tips for Managing Screen Time:

  • Avoid screens before bed: Refrain from using electronic devices for at least an hour before bedtime.
  • Use blue light filters: If you must use screens before bed, use blue light filters or apps that reduce blue light emission.
  • Dim your screens: Lower the brightness of your screens to reduce eye strain and minimize the impact of blue light.

Monitoring Blood Glucose Levels Regularly

Regularly monitoring blood glucose levels is a crucial aspect of managing diabetes and ensuring effective control. Self-monitoring allows individuals to track how various factors, such as diet, exercise, and medication, affect their blood sugar. This information helps them make informed decisions and adjust their treatment plan as needed.

1. Understanding Blood Glucose Meters

A blood glucose meter is a device used to measure the amount of glucose in a sample of blood, typically obtained by pricking a fingertip.

Key Features of Blood Glucose Meters:

  • Accuracy: Measures blood glucose levels with a high degree of accuracy.
  • Ease of use: Simple to operate, with easy-to-read displays.
  • Portability: Compact and portable, allowing for convenient monitoring anywhere.
  • Memory: Stores previous readings, enabling tracking of blood glucose trends over time.

2. How to Use a Blood Glucose Meter

Using a blood glucose meter involves a few simple steps:

  1. Wash your hands: Thoroughly wash and dry your hands before testing.
  2. Prepare the lancing device: Insert a new lancet into the lancing device.
  3. Obtain a blood sample: Prick your fingertip with the lancing device to draw a small drop of blood.
  4. Apply blood to the test strip: Place the blood sample on the test strip inserted into the meter.
  5. Read the result: Wait for the meter to display your blood glucose level.
  6. Record the result: Log your blood glucose reading in a notebook or electronic tracking app.

3. When to Check Your Blood Glucose

The frequency of blood glucose monitoring depends on several factors, including the type of diabetes, treatment plan, and individual needs.

General Guidelines for Blood Glucose Monitoring:

  • Before meals: Check your blood glucose before breakfast, lunch, and dinner.
  • Two hours after meals: Monitor your blood glucose two hours after the start of each meal.
  • Before bedtime: Check your blood glucose before going to bed.
  • Before, during, and after exercise: Monitor your blood glucose before, during, and after physical activity.
  • When you feel unwell: Check your blood glucose if you experience symptoms of high or low blood sugar.

4. Understanding Blood Glucose Targets

Healthcare professionals typically set target blood glucose ranges for individuals with diabetes. These ranges may vary based on age, overall health, and other individual factors.

Typical Blood Glucose Targets for Adults with Diabetes:

  • Before meals: 80-130 mg/dL (4.4-7.2 mmol/L)
  • Two hours after meals: Less than 180 mg/dL (10.0 mmol/L)

5. Interpreting Blood Glucose Results

Understanding your blood glucose results can help you identify patterns and make informed decisions about your diet, exercise, and medication.

High Blood Glucose (Hyperglycemia):

  • Possible causes: Overeating, consuming high-carbohydrate foods, insufficient insulin or medication, stress, illness.
  • Symptoms: Increased thirst, frequent urination, blurred vision, fatigue, headache.

Low Blood Glucose (Hypoglycemia):

  • Possible causes: Skipping meals, excessive insulin or medication, intense exercise, alcohol consumption.
  • Symptoms: Shakiness, sweating, dizziness, hunger, confusion, irritability.
